Dendrobium D-1

Britain’s answer to the small-scale electric hypercar is this – an 1,800bhp, aerodynamically sophisticated machine that’s been designed, developed and built in the UK. Williams Advanced Engineering has been drafted in to help out, so it’s safe to expect that this will be a seriously capable car when it arrives.
